Scope note: A DNA-binding orphan nuclear receptor that has specificity for directly repeated (DR) AGGTCA sequences. It binds DNA as either as a homodimer or as a heterodimer with the closely-related orphan nuclear receptor NUCLEAR RECEPTOR SUBFAMILY 2, GROUP C, MEMBER 2. The protein was originally identified as a PROSTATE-specific protein and is involved in the regulation of variety of cellular processes, including CELL DIFFERENTIATION; CELL PROLIFERATION; and APOPTOSIS.
